#include "curl_setup.h"
|
|
|
|
#include "strcase.h"
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* curl_strequal() is for doing "raw" case insensitive strings. This is meant
|
|
* to be locale independent and only compare strings we know are safe for
|
|
* this. See https://daniel.haxx.se/blog/2008/10/15/strcasecmp-in-turkish/ for
|
|
* further explanations as to why this function is necessary.
|
|
*/
|
|
|
|
static int casecompare(const char *first, const char *second)
|
|
{
|
|
while(*first) {
|
|
if(Curl_raw_toupper(*first) != Curl_raw_toupper(*second))
|
|
/* get out of the loop as soon as they do not match */
|
|
return 0;
|
|
first++;
|
|
second++;
|
|
}
|
|
/* If we are here either the strings are the same or the length is different.
|
|
We can test if the "current" character is non-zero for one and zero
|
|
for the other. Note that the characters may not be exactly the same even
|
|
if they match, we only want to compare zero-ness. */
|
|
return !*first == !*second;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
static int ncasecompare(const char *first, const char *second, size_t max)
|
|
{
|
|
while(*first && max) {
|
|
if(Curl_raw_toupper(*first) != Curl_raw_toupper(*second))
|
|
return 0;
|
|
max--;
|
|
first++;
|
|
second++;
|
|
}
|
|
if(max == 0)
|
|
return 1; /* they are equal this far */
|
|
|
|
return Curl_raw_toupper(*first) == Curl_raw_toupper(*second);
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Only "raw" case insensitive strings. This is meant to be locale independent
|
|
* and only compare strings we know are safe for this.
|
|
*
|
|
* The function is capable of comparing a-z case insensitively.
|
|
*
|
|
* Result is 1 if text matches and 0 if not.
|
|
*/
|
|
|
|
/* --- public function --- */
|
|
int curl_strequal(const char *s1, const char *s2)
|
|
{
|
|
if(s1 && s2)
|
|
/* both pointers point to something then compare them */
|
|
return casecompare(s1, s2);
|
|
|
|
/* if both pointers are NULL then treat them as equal */
|
|
return NULL == s1 && NULL == s2;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/* --- public function --- */
|
|
int curl_strnequal(const char *s1, const char *s2, size_t n)
|
|
{
|
|
if(s1 && s2)
|
|
/* both pointers point to something then compare them */
|
|
return ncasecompare(s1, s2, n);
|
|
|
|
/* if both pointers are NULL then treat them as equal if max is non-zero */
|
|
return NULL == s1 && NULL == s2 && n;
|
|
}
